Research Abstract |
This virtual object handling system can be used for applications of interactive 3D modeling such as industrial design and field of art. For realizing direct handling of virtual object with high accuracy and really existing sensation, a special type of stylus was developed. The grip of stylus is mounted on the driving mechanism, however, the pointed end is a virtual object displayed as if united with the grip. A fast eyes positions measuring system using PSD and special graphics processor were developed for display of realistic motion parallax. This virtual pointed end enables not only direct handling, but also real time touch decision using graphics hardware. So it enables transmission of the sense of touch from virtual object by controlling the grip supporting mechanism.
